Product Attributes
Attribute Specification Options
Material Solid Carbide
Type Micro End Mill / Micro Diameter Milling Cutter
Cutting Diameter (D) 0.1mm – 3.0mm (customizable)
Shank Diameter (d) 3mm / 4mm (standard)
Flute Length (L1) 1mm – 10mm (depending on diameter)
Overall Length (L) 38mm – 60mm
Number of Flutes 2 / 3 Flutes
Helix Angle 30°–40°
Tolerance ±0.005mm – Ultra-High Precision
Coating Options TiAlN, AlTiN, DLC, or Uncoated

FAQ

Q1: What is a Micro End Mill?
A: A Micro End Mill is a miniature-sized milling cutter (down to 0.1mm diameter) used for precision machining of very small features.

Q2: What industries use micro end mills?
A: Commonly used in electronics, medical devices, aerospace, precision molds, watchmaking, and optical parts.

Q3: What is the minimum cutting diameter available?
A: As small as 0.1mm, depending on requirements.

Q4: What is the advantage over standard end mills?
A: Micro end mills provide higher precision, smoother finishes, and the ability to machine tiny, detailed features.

Q5: What coatings are recommended?
A: DLC coating is excellent for non-ferrous materials, while TiAlN / AlTiN is best for steels and hardened materials.
